This guide outlines the main steps that you need to follow in order to integrate and configure WebSpellChecker Proofreader with a new auto-searching functionality. All the described steps are provided for the Cloud version of WebSpellChecker Proofreader.

Supported Integrations

Here is list of most common uses cases of the WSC Proofreader integration in your web app:

The autoSearch feature will take care of detecting new editable fields on the page and enabling proofreading in them automatically on focus. There are no additional actions or plugins requires for enabling WSC Proofreader in a specific WYSIWYG editor or HTML editable control. A single configuration applies to almost all editors and controls.
